国家精品课程大型数据库管理系统应用与开发的建设

2015-05-30 10:48:04任淑美朱亚兴余爱民
计算机教育 2015年12期
关键词:学习情境资源共享课程设计

任淑美 朱亚兴 余爱民

摘要:大型数据库管理系统应用与开发是软件技术专业核心课程,相应的技能是大型应用软件开发人员的必备技能之一。文章阐述将本课程升级建设为国家级精品资源共享课程的建设过程中,与企业和行业专家深度合作,以真实项目为载体,精心选取和重新构建教学内容及实训项目,创设“搭建系统的开发环境”“熟悉使用SQL*PLUS工具”“Oracle用户管理”等11个典型工作情境,同时对培养目标、课程内容、课程资源、教学创新等进行全新设计,实现项目驱动、任务引领的教、学、做一体化教学目标。

关键词:大型数据库;课程设计;学习情境;精品资源;资源共享;教学质量

0 引言

大型数据库管理系统应用与开发是软件技术专业的核心学习课程。熟练掌握数据库开发和最基本的Oracle数据库应用与管理,是大型应用软件开发人员的基本必备技能之一。广东省的社会经济发展对计算机技术和电子信息需求较大,省教育厅在精品课程建设方面尤其对计算机类课程的建设很重视。自2003年国家启动精品课程建设以来,我国已形成了国家、省、校三级建设体系。本课程在计算机软件技术专业中处于核心地位,于2013年成功申报为国家级精品资源共享课程进行开发与建设。

1 课程建设目标

培养目标的制订是依据行业发展和相应岗位对人才的需求而确立的。在Oracle数据库应用行业,职业岗位是Oracle数据库开发工程师和Oracle数据库管理员,其要求掌握的专业知识如图1所示。

2 课程建设思路

大型数据库管理系统(Oracle)应用开发课程建设以就业为导向,以培养学生职业能力为重点,以培养岗位工作技能为核心,以校企专兼职教师对职业岗位群的工作过程分析为基础,充分利用校内、校外实习基地以及网络教学资源,实现学生教、学、做一体化。

2.1 采用项目驱动、任务引领的方式实现课程的实践性,校企合作共同开发和建设课程

学校教师与企业工程师合作,双方按照培养目标对知识结构的要求,共同制订课程标准。例如,在大型数据库应用开发的课程标准制订过程中,原设计方案按照ORACLE 91的版本制订,而来自企业的工程师以为采用ORACLEIOG更合适,校企双方经研讨后达成一致,采用ORACLE IOG撰写课标。对合作开发的真实项目,专职和兼职教师积极合作,从中提取既具有代表性、又易于理解的企业真实项目作为教学案例,如人事管理系统、珠海知识产权电子证据网等,可取得很好的教学效果。

2.2 面向学生自主构建课程交互式网络教学平台,服务学生,体现课程的开放性

课程组自行开发了基于工作任务的交互式网络教学平台,通过该平台将人事管理系统的开发过程贯穿于整个网络教学;结合Oracle数据库的学习曰标,将教学内容重新编排和序化,将“工作过程中的学习”和“课堂上的学习”整合为一体,实现教学做一体化、理论与项目实训一体化(交互网络教学平台网址:http://61.145.229.21/orapms/)。

2.3 通过教学仿真实训系统拓宽学生知识面,深化学生自主学习

课程组充分利用了自行研发的大型数据库Oracle教学仿真实训系统。该系统令学生可动态体验雇员管理、考勤管理、系统管理等功能,每一步操作能够实时、动态地显示所涉及的任一Oracle数据库对应知识的源代码,包括基本的SQL语法、函数的应用、子查询、触发器等,生动灵活地展现相关知识点的具体应用,拓宽学生知识面,促进自主学习的进一步深化。

3 课程内容设置

3.1 课程内容设置的基本原则

Oracle数据库管理系统安全性能高、稳定性能好,其系统本身较为复杂,学习难度大,另外乐于动手、可塑性较强的高职学生相较于本科乍在学习能力上略有差距。基于此,课程组根据课程特点、学生情况以及企业行业对技能的要求,分析要获得这些技能应当具备的知识结构,从而确定设置哪些内容作为本课程的必修内容。

3.2 课程内容的选取方法

教师可根据数据库应用与开发人才岗位所需的职业能力和素养要求选取课程内容,可选择企业信息系统应用的典型案例“人事管理系统”作为具体的教学内容;将此项目的系统功能模块按照工作流程分解成若干真实工作任务,设置课程内容和学习情境,使学生能够将所学内容紧密结合岗位工作任务实际,在基于工作过程的学习中增强岗位技能,获取职业能力。本课程选取的具体内容见表1。

3.3 教学形式的组织

(1)整体安排教学内容,以“人事管理系统”的开发工作流程贯穿整个教学过程,将基于工作任务的教学内容序化设计为相应的学习情境,将工作过程中的学习和课堂上的学习融为一体。

(2)采用项目导向、任务驱动的方式,合理设计课程内容的引入、讲解、示范、讨论、实训、归纳提高等过程,采用教、学、做一体化的形式带动学生自主学习,利用恰当的工作任务进行能力训练。

(3)按照学习情境实施教学。该课程设计了11个典型的学习情境,前10个按照实际工作流程组织,层层递进,逐步实现系统的功能;最后1个学习情境是前面所学内容的综合,是利用JSP工具开发的仿真系统,强化巩固所学内容,培养学生独立完成工作任务的能力。

(4)在每个学习情境中均将项目开发任务转化为若干个子任务,进而转化为子任务。以任务的引入激发学生的学习兴趣,让学生通过主动查找和掌握所需知识完成各个任务。每个子任务的学习过程都注重教、学、做相结合,贯穿从教师演示或引导递进到学生自主学习和独立完成任务的思想,以项目为载体,以实训为手段,实现理论与实践一体化。

(5)教学过程中注重培养学生分析和解决问题的能力、融入真实工作环境的能力、按照规范和要隶实施安全操作的能力以及项目合作中的协作能力、自我学习能力和可持续发展能力。

3.4 学习情境的具体设计

根据学生的认知水平,教师可从工作过程与学习实际需求出发,序化教学内容,合理设计学习情境。教学中设计了以项目典型工作任务为载体的11个学习情境,将知识与技能、理论与实践、素质训练等融入每个学习情境,培养和提高学生的综合职业能力。11个学习情境的学习内容及指导见表2。

4 课程资源建设

4.1 自主建设网络教学资源和多媒体教学资源

学校投资建设现代数字化校园,已建成千兆光纤主干带宽校园网,拥有2万多个信息点,外部互联网接口为2个100 Mbps。根据专业特色,学校可自主建设网络教学资源,包括多媒体计算机机房、云计算中心、数字媒体教学体验中心、现代化教学设备等。教师在教学过程中,可以充分利用多媒体教学资源和网络教学资源。

按照国家精品资源共享课建设的要求,学校可在课程网站上提供相应的全套网络教学资源;针对每一个学习情境的内容制作教师授课录像、多媒体课件、企业案例、项目实训、操作演示、学习指南、配套习题、任务工单等23项相关学习资源;自主开发在线练习与考试系统并配备专用服务器,使学生可随时进行网上学习与考试,教师可以方便地在网上与学生进行交流;在课程网站上设置针对每一学习情境的在线练习,设置网络课堂栏目(包括课程资源、教学平台、在线练习、常见问题解答)、企业项目栏目(来自于企业的真实工学结合或外包项目,由课程组专职教师带领学生共同完成)、课外拓展栏目等。

4.2 提供丰富的网络资源链接

学校还可在课程网站上提供大量有关Oracle内容的网络资源链接,如国内Oracle相关站点、Oracle讨论区、Oracle软件下载站点、Oracle第三方工具站点、大专院校BBS等;充分利用学校图书馆提供的电子资源库如超星数字图书馆、CNKI中国知网数据库、广东网络图书馆资源等,为学生通过网络获取学习资源提供良好的条件。

4.3 提供实训条件

校企共建实训基地并充分利用校企合作资源是课程资源建设的主要手段。学校可与企业合作共建实训室和实训基地,为学生创建真实的企业软件开发环境。广东科学技术职业学院软件技术专业共有10个校内专业实训室,设备投资总值超千万元,如学校投资建设的“E-仿真实训室”、中央财政资助的“计算机应用与软件技术实训基地”。由广东省财政资助的与企业联合建设的“软件技术与工程中心”和“移动应用开发中心”两个教学基地,技术装备先进,集教学、培训和技术服务等功能为一体,实训面积达600㎡,能容纳超过140个软件企业相关岗位人员进行相关的开发工作。

软件技术专业与南方软件园、珠海金山软件公司、珠海高泰科技有限公司等100多家公司签订共建校外实训基地合同,其中在专业上深度合作的有10家。这些企业接收学生实习,能够为大型数据库管理系统应用与开发课程的实践教学提供真实的工程环境。为增强校内实训的效果,校内实训以模拟企业工作流程的形式进行组织,按照企业真实开发规范和管理要求进行项目开发;实施企业管理模式,提高学生的岗位适应能力。在校内企业级实训基地,学生以“准员工”身份,按照企业规范和流程完成项目的开发和实施;教师在准员工的考核上结合企业考核标准,按实习企业员工所需具有的职业能力和素养(态度、作风等)进行考核,由企业和指导教师提供实习考核成绩。考核评价要素为工作任务50%(工作量15%、工作质量20%、工作进度15%)、工作态度15%、团队合作20%、规章制度15%(工作总结计划5%、备份源程序5%、工作纪律5%)、激励加分(30分),以此促使学生提高岗位适应能力。

广东科学技术职业学院是Oracle Academy项目的合作院校.获得了Oracle公司提供的课程体系、正版软件和技术支持以及Oracle Academy骨干教师的培训资格、Oracle认证培训和考试的优惠条件,具有了参加Oracle公司组织的活动的机会。目前,我们已在实训基地安装了250套Oracle数据库管理系统,建成了Oracle数据库技术仿真实训环境,学生可以在这里完成所有的教学和实践项目。

5 教学创新

5.1 引入真实过程,设计教学模式

教师可将软件项目开发工作中的真实过程与任务引入教学设计,精心设计教学模式;将企业真实项目“人事管理系统”的开发过程融入整个教学,将11个学习情境贯穿于整个工作过程和学习过程。具体教学模式如图2所示。

5.2 有针对性地进行职业能力训练,以学生为主体开展企业真实项目外包实训

教师可引入企业兼职教师设计开发的项目进行综合实训,开展有针对性的职业能力训练;组织学生团队独立参与一个企业实际项目(或模拟企业真实项目)的开发,在校内实训基地按照企业规范和流程完成项目的实施,使学生了解项目的整个开发过程,掌握软件开发中相关文档、需求分析、系统设计、完成计划等的书写规范,提升从事应用软件开发的职业能力。近几年,广东科学技术职业学院软件技术专业在多赢思维的前提下,利用学校人力、物力等资源大力开展深度校企合作,充分开发真实生产性资源,给学生提供丰富的实训和顶岗实习机会。具体方法是组建师生联合团队承接企业真实的外包项目。

承接外包项目时,教师可以学生为团队主体,指定项目组长,以来自于企业的真实项目(如人事管理系统、珠海知识产权电子证据网、联通招生报到服务系统等)作为学生的综合实训项目:全程按照企业真实开发环境制度和管理模式要求学生,依据真实项目背景介绍、客户需求分析、系统功能说明让学生制订开发计划;要求开发团队成员明确划分任务、实行项目开发过程监控、记录工作日志、填写周报和小组会议记录等,参与项目验收。通过项目的仿真实训,学生能够获得相关的工作经验,提高完成企业工作任务的专业能力。

5.3 改革课程考核方式,灵活采用多种教学方法

课程考核评价上,我们采用校内学习、校内实训、企业实习、主流职业资格考试等形式进行全方位综合评价;同时开展国际合作,获得了北大青鸟与北京甲骨文软件系统有限公司的Oracle联合认证授权,加入Oracle Academy学院进行双证书教育。评价方法主要是过程性评价与目标性评价相结合、理论与实践相结合、技能与职业态度相结合、笔试与操作相结合、开卷与闭卷相结合、校内教师评价与企业专家评价相结合等,以考核学生的各项能力,进行综合评价。

在教学过程中,教师可根据不同的学习情境和教学环节、学习任务和内容的难易程度,采用灵活多样的教学方法。

(1)启发引导教学法。设计有启发性的工作问题,提出工作任务,令学生对知识点所涉及的原理有透彻而又深入的理解,能够举一反三,融会贯通,提高学习效率。

(2)任务驱动教学法。教师提出具体任务和要求并进行引导,使学生通过实际操作加深对知识点的理解;教师讲解难点、重点并给出应用实例,开拓学生思路,鼓励学生创新。

(3)分组讨沦教学法。学生以小组为单位,根据学习任务积极探索与讨沦,提出问题并解决问题,增强团队合作精神和沟通意识。

(4)情境体验教学法。教师有目的地引入或创设一些具体的场景,令学生有更好的体验,加深对专业知识的理解。

(5)案例分析教学法。教师可根据教学目标和内容的需要,采用案例组织学生进行学习研究,培养学生成为解决实际问题的“智慧高手”。

5.4 建设课程资源

除了自主建设网络教学资源和多媒体教学资源,提供丰富的网络资源链接和实训条件建设外,我们还非常注重教材的建设,旨在从总体上构成一个“大型数据库管理系统(Oracle)应用与开发”的资源环境。根据课程组主讲教师多年的教学和项目开发经验,在与企业合作共同开发课程资源的基础上,课程组成员于2012年6月编写出版了国家精品课程配套教材《Oraclc数据库系统应用开发实用教程》一书,由高等教育出版社出版。该教材针对高技能人才的培养特点和目标,提炼整合了Oracle最基本、最核心的实用技术和原理作为教程内容。教材行文通俗易懂,以易学、易懂、易做为写作基准,循序渐进地介绍Oracle数据库应用和开发的基本知识。教材对实验内容和结构作了精心编排,针对不同的实训内容配有实例指导或实践训练。在实践训练中,教材针对相关的知识与技能列出了一些能举一反三的题目,以使学生通过学习能熟练掌握技能,理解基本原理。

6 结语

国家精品资源共享课程的开发与建设是一项长期的、综合性的系统工程,不仅需要较深的专业知识和技能,还需要丰富的一线教学经验和捕捉前沿信息的职业敏感,同时还需要课程组全体成员团结协作并具备顽强的毅力和坚持不懈的努力精神。建设高职国家精品资源共享课程要精益求精,不断完善和补充新的内容,学习同行的先进经验,鼓励教师、教学管理人员和学生积极参与,同时带动其他课程的建设,促进教学水平的整体提高。

猜你喜欢
学习情境资源共享课程设计
交通运输数据资源共享交换体系探究与实现
龙凤元素系列课程设计
少儿美术(2019年1期)2019-12-14 08:01:34
卫康与九天绿资源共享
刍议小学语文教学与信息技术的整合
探讨数学教学中学习情境的创设方法
文理导航(2016年32期)2016-12-19 21:23:59
高职高专《安装工程计量与计价》课程教学改革的探索与实践
基于工作过程的工程造价专业课程体系开发的实践
教育部第一批“国家级精品资源共享课”公布
基于Articulate Storyline的微课程设计与开发
中小学电教(2016年3期)2016-03-01 03:40:53
测量学精品资源共享课建设的探索